Patient involved in a car crash. Has a lacerated tongue , is responsive to painful stimuli, has a low BP,
High HR, shock symptoms, respirations are fast and shallow. What do you do first? - (ANSWER)Clear the
airway and suction



Patient has a head injury from a brick. He is moaning, has unequal pupils, high BP, low HR. What
condition is the patient presenting? - (ANSWER)Cerebra Herniation

Note: Cushing's Triad



You are splint a deformed humerus. You notice no distal pulse. What do you do next? -
(ANSWER)Loosen the splint and recheck MSPs.



How do you handle arterial bleeding from a forearm laceration? - (ANSWER)Tourniquet



Patient falls 24 feet and lands on their side. They have trouble breathing, bruising on the chest, holding
their chest. What condition is the patient presenting? - (ANSWER)Flail Segment



A 25 year old male was involved in a head on MVC. The patient was unrestrained, Days later the patient
shows a distended abdomen and is hot to the touch. His vital signs are normal. What condition is the
patient showing? - (ANSWER)Ruptured Bowel



Patient has been assaulted. Prior to the assault he had two drinks. Patient has blurry vision, slurred
speech, stumbling, high BP and low HR. What condition is the patient presenting? - (ANSWER)Epidural
Hematoma



Patient fell on the steps the night before. The patient is now unresponsive, deformity to the wrist,
bruising around the navel (Cullen's sign). What condition is the patient presenting? -
(ANSWER)Internal/Intraabdominal Bleeding



Patient is found slumped in a chair. He admitted to attempting suicide by taking pills and cutting his
wrist. He has slurred speech, slow and oozing blood from the wrist (dark red), low BP, high HR, 18
respirations per minute. How do you treat this patient? - (ANSWER)Ask about suicide ideation

, EMT FISDAP TRAUMA EXAM UPDATE GUARANTEED PASS PRIORITY EXAM BEST GRADE
A+




35 year old patient was assaulted 36 hours before. He has a head injury, lost consciousness. Now
patient's level of consciousness had gone from agitated to confused. What condition is the patient
presenting? - (ANSWER)Epidural Hematoma



A 26 year old was involved in a MVC. Left lung sounds are distant, there is asymmetrical chest rise. What
do you do next? - (ANSWER)Give patient respirations with BVM



When caring for more than one patient, when do you change your gloves? - (ANSWER)When switching
from one patient to the next.



29 year old was shot in the chest. Absent carotid pulse, JVD, and minimal chest wall movement. How do
you treat this patient? - (ANSWER)Needle Decompression



24 year old was pulled from a fire. Patient has full thickness burns to both arms distal to the elbow,
chest and head. What percentage of the body is burned based on the rule of 9's. - (ANSWER)27%



There is a large contusion in the LUQ of the abdomen. Wat organ is most likely affected? -
(ANSWER)Spleen



20 year old was found facedown in a pool. Bystanders say he struck his head jumping into the pool.
What do do you do first for the patient? - (ANSWER)Turn him over so he is supine



36 year old patient is struck by flying debris. Patient has shortness of breath, low BP, rapid respirations
and flat neck veins. What condition is the patient presenting? - (ANSWER)Hemothorax



What do electric and hydrofluoric acid burns have in common? - (ANSWER)Usually are worse than
initially expected



45 year old patient is unconscious, has diminished breath sounds, subcutaneous emphysema around the
neck and a history of asthma. What condition is the patient presenting? - (ANSWER)Fractured
trachea/Tracheal tear
